Fred de Sam Lazaro reports on India Prime Minster Narendra Modi's pro-business policies.

India Prime Minister Narendra Modi has amassed many supporters in the country who praise his economic vision by creating jobs and improving the country's infrastructure. But staunch critics argue many states, whose residents live below the country's poverty line, are still lacking in education and health care, and that his election has emboldened Hindu extremists. Fred de Sam Lazaro reports.
